PSTET 2023 Exam Pattern

The candidate must be aware of the exam pattern of the PSTET 2023 exam which is given below:

There will be two papers of PSTET 2023.

  1. Paper-I will be for a teacher for classes I to V.
  2. Paper-II will be for a teacher for classes VI to VIII.
Note: A candidate who intends to be a teacher for both levels (classes I to V and classes VI to VIII) will have to appear in both the papers (Paper I and Paper II).
Exam Pattern for PSTET 2023 Exam
Duration 1hr 30 mins (90 minutes)
Type of Question MCQ (Multiple Choice Question)
Number of Question150
Marking Scheme

(+1)for every right answer

There will be no negative marking.

Paper 1

PSTET sections

Number of MCQs

Marks

Child Development and Pedagogy

30

30

Environmental Studies

30

30

Mathematics

30

30

Language I

30

30

Language II

30

30

Total

150

150

Paper 2

PSTET sections

Number of MCQs

Marks

Child Development and Pedagogy

30

30

Language I

30

30

Language II

30

30

Mathematics and Science (for Mathematics and Science teacher)

Or, Social Studies (for Social studies teacher)

Or, any of the above groups (for any other subject)

 

60

60

Total

150

150
